DETAILS OF VACANCY
PROJECT DEVELOPMENT OFFICER I
No. of Vacancy : 1
Terms of Employment : Cost of Service
Item Number : N/A
Area of Assignment : Alabang, Muntinlupa
Program / Office : Protective Service Division - Supplementary Feeding Program
Salary : SG 11/ ₱27,000.00
Vacancy Code : 0418-026
Deadline of Application is on May 23, 2024
QUALIFICATIONS
Eligibility : None required
Education : Bachelor's Degree preferably BS in Nutrition & Dietetics or related courses
Training : 4 hours of relevant training
Experience : 1 year of relevant work experience
JOB FUNCTIONS
Assist the Field Office in complying with the trust, directives and plans prescribed by the FO by responding to queries, conduct monitoring, provide technical assistance and guidance to LGUs on SFP operations concerns ensuring timely implementation;
Prepare technical reports based on monitoring and technical assistance provided to LGUs as reference on the provision services to beneficiaries;
Review, consolidate and monitor physical accomplishments of the assigned province in coordination with the LGU focal person and FOs;
Submit monthly / quarterly consolidated accomplishment report of assigned area which includes monitoring and evaluation of SFP reports submitted by LGUs with analysis and recommendation;
Prepare, consolidate and submit documentation reports of LGUs which includes documentation of good practices, augmentation support of LGUs to SFP funds and other significant accomplishments;
Preparation of documents for the procurements of SFP food commodities based on approved cycle menu of their assigned area which includes but not limited to Purchase Request (PR), Purchase Orders (PO), Project Procurement Management Plan (PPMP);
Preparation and consolidation of inventory of advocacy materials (measuring tools, eating/ cooking utensils etc.) as basis for distribution to partner LGUs;
Review, asses and recommend requests for advocacy materials (measuring tools, eating/ cooking utensils) submitted by LGUs for approval of Regional Focal Person;
Coordinate with the LGUs for the timely submission of SFP reports including the liquidation report for transfer of funds;
Attends to meetings consultation and coordination with partner stakeholders and concerned agencies; and,
Performs other project related tasks that may be assigned by the Regional Focal Person.
EXPECTED OUTPUTS
Monthly Report on the Physical/ Financial Accomplishment of assigned area;
Reports on the conducted monitoring/ technical assistance to partner LGUs and other stakeholders;
Quarterly Report that includes monitoring and evaluation of SFP Reports submitted by LGUs with analysis and recommendation;
Inventory of advocacy materials (measuring tools, eating/ cooking utensil etc.) as basis for distribution to partner LGUs;
Documentation Report of LGUs which includes documentation of good practices, augmentation support of LGUs to SFP funds and other significant accomplishments.
